Kōh-e Allāh Sang
Kōh-e Allāh Sang is a mountain in Chaki Wardak, Maidan Wardak Province and has an elevation of 3,350 metres. Kōh-e Allāh Sang is situated nearby to the locality Bāghak, as well as near ‘Alī Shāh.- Type: Mountain with an elevation of 3,350 metres
- Description: mountain in Afghanistan
- Also known as: “Gory Alasang”, “Kōh-e ‘Alá Sang”, “Koh-e Allah Sang”, “Kohe Alasang”, “Kūh-e Alahsang”, “Kūh-e Alasang”, and “کوه الاه سنگ”
